A well known cricket team has a schedule tour of XYZ country in some days. They want to make sure to provide good security to the national team. Different security members have visited this country to check security arrangements. Some are agreed while some has little concerns. There are 4 different members who have visited in different period of time. The tour can go as schedule if there are at-least 3 members have submitted the positive report about security arrangements but if two members submit positive report while two other members submit negative report then there will be a deadlock between decision so there can be a don’t care condition. Now you have to design a Combination Circuit which can satisfy this scenario.
